American Saddlebred Museum Receives Grant from the Junior League of Lexington



The American Saddlebred Museum is pleased to receive a Community Education and Research Grant from the Junior League of Lexington. Grant funding will support the purchase of archival supplies to house the Museum’s historic collection of Horse Show Ribbons. This collection includes objects dating from 1903 to present day.  Significant objects include ribbons awarded to great horses including CHWing Commander, CHYorktown, CHLocal Talent  and many others.  

Museum Executive Director, Jennifer Foster says: “Proper preservation of the collection is always a priority for the Museum.  We are pleased that the Junior League of Lexington recognizes the importance of preservation, particularly for objects related to the American Saddlebred.” As a textile, proper storage is critical for the long-term preservation of these historic show ribbons. This grant will support and sustain these important pieces of Saddlebred history.
